What Is Candid Wedding Photography?

Capturing Real, Unposed Moments

Candid photography focuses on natural moments — the laughter, the tears, the spontaneous hugs, the authentic interactions between you and your loved ones. These images are not staged. The photographer blends into the environment and observes genuine emotions as they happen.

The Storytelling Approach

Candid photography is all about storytelling. It documents the wedding day as it unfolds, highlighting real memories rather than crafted poses. This style is ideal for couples who want their gallery to feel emotional, warm, and honest.

What Is Editorial Wedding Photography?

Inspired by Fashion Magazines

Editorial wedding photography takes inspiration from magazines like Vogue, Harper’s Bazaar, and Elle. The poses are polished, the lighting is intentional, and the composition is artistic. This style is about creating high-end, cinematic images that look like they belong in a luxury publication.

Styling, Direction, and Precision

Unlike candid photography, editorial images involve direction from the photographer. We guide you on posture, expressions, hand placement, angles, and positioning to create striking portraits. Every detail is deliberately crafted.

The Emotional Impact of Candid Photography

Capturing Tears, Laughter, and Authentic Reactions

One of the biggest advantages of candid photography is emotional authenticity. When people don’t feel the pressure of posing, their true personality shines through. The result feels organic, heartfelt, and deeply meaningful.

Preserving Real Memories

Years from now, the images of your dad wiping his eyes or your partner’s reaction during the first look will matter more than you can imagine. Candid photography preserves the moments you may miss during the rush of the day.

Perfect for Reliving the Day

When couples view their candid photos, they often say, “I didn’t even know this moment happened!” That’s the beauty of documentary-style storytelling — it completes the emotional timeline of your wedding.

The Artistic Value of Editorial Photography

Creating Magazine-Worthy Images

Editorial photography transforms you into the stars of your own luxury shoot. These are the photos couples often frame or print large for their homes. Editorial images have a clean, timeless quality that feels cinematic and intentional.

Highlighting Beauty, Fashion, and Details

Your dress, suit, jewelry, veil, makeup, bouquet — all these stunning elements deserve to be photographed like artwork. Editorial photography focuses on crafting flawless, structured portraits that highlight the wedding fashion you carefully chose.

Perfect for Portrait Sessions

Your couple portraits, bridal portraits, and bridal party photos benefit immensely from editorial direction. With clear posing guidance, the results become dramatic, elegant, and elevated.
